Output 750384770b0d58b326443c29da4cfe990b8c0b39780f80b2e0e818ab7273efe0:0

value
650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c18b3f884d7c2b55e1b6b08e4ef09c95ac034817 OP_EQUAL
address
3KLP9hYBRSrJTCvQsBfivNgBt9cLApeWBQ
transaction
750384770b0d58b326443c29da4cfe990b8c0b39780f80b2e0e818ab7273efe0